Mastering Grenade Physics: How to Use Each Type Effectively in CSGO
In Counter-Strike: Global Offensive (CSGO), understanding the intricacies of grenade physics is essential for gaining a tactical advantage. Each type of grenade serves a unique purpose and mastering their use can significantly influence the outcome of matches. For instance, the high-explosive grenade (HE Grenade) is designed to cause damage to opponents in a confined space. When thrown, it explodes after a brief delay, making its timing crucial. Effective players often use it to weaken multiple enemies grouped together, allowing for easier engagements. Remember to account for the range and angle of your throw; an improper toss can result in wasted resources.
Another vital component is the smoke grenade, which conceals vision and creates strategic opportunities. Learning how to deploy it effectively can block enemy sightlines and cover team movements. A well-placed smoke can help in executing bomb plants or retaking sites. To excel in using smoke grenades, familiarize yourself with common smoke spots on maps and practice your throws, ensuring that they land exactly where needed. Additionally, don't overlook the flashbang; its utility lies in disorienting enemies. Flashbangs can turn the tide during engagements, but remember to communicate with your team to prevent accidental blinding.

Common Mistakes with Grenades in CSGO and How to Avoid Them
When it comes to using grenades in CSGO, many players, especially newcomers, often make critical mistakes that can lead to wasted resources and missed opportunities. One common error is the misuse of grenades in inappropriate situations. For example, using a smoke grenade when it’s unnecessary can obstruct your teammates' vision, while tossing a flashbang in confined spaces may end up blinding both your allies and enemies. To avoid these mishaps, it is crucial to evaluate the situation on the battlefield and understand when each grenade is most effective. Consider using a created tactics approach that highlights specific scenarios for deploying each type of grenade.
Another frequent mistake involves ignorance of the grenade's mechanics and its trajectory. Many players throw grenades without practicing how they bounce or roll, which can result in them landing in unintended locations. This is particularly evident with Molotovs and Incendiary grenades. To improve your grenade skills, take time in offline modes to practice throwing grenades at various angles and distances. This ensures you learn the optimal techniques for their use, ultimately enhancing your gameplay experience.
